Unknown gunmen strike Rajouri village killing five persons and injuring several

Four people were killed and nine injured after militants fired at three houses in Rajouri district on Sunday evening. On Monday, a child died and four people were hurt after a blast took place near the same houses. The cause of the blast was not immediately clear. Top police officials have started an investigation into the incidents. Sunday’s attack has triggered protests and strikes in Rajouri as people blamed the local administration for the security lapse. Four civilians killed, Six injured in suspected terror attack in Rajouri

At least four civilians were killed and six were injured after unidentified armed men, in a suspected terror attack, indiscriminately opened fire in Jammu and Kashmir’s Rajouri district on Sunday evening, police said. While a senior police officer, later in the day, said the incident was a terror attack, additional director general of police (ADGP) Mukesh Singh said it was yet to be confirmed.
